GRIMES

Visions

2012-03-04

Canadian singer/producer, Claire Boucher makes electro-pop on her fourth release (in two years) as Grimes. The liner notes compare her music to that of Enya, TLC, and Aphex Twin. I think that description is right on target. Visions features well-produced vocals with effects a la Enya, sung to a synth soundtrack a la Aphex Twin (or maybe Kraftwerk), and done with a dance pop attitude a la TLC. Rebecca Ruth
